VAT changes in Romania

10 September 2015

The International Monetary Fund and the EU, which oversaw Romania’s bailout during the financial crisis, have opposed its plan to cut its VAT rate to 19%.  In response to this, the Romanian Parliament has now confirmed that it will reduce its standard VAT rate from 24% to 20% on 1 January 2016, and then from 20% to 19% in January 2017.
